60 years old with history of palpitations
Present with attack of tachycardia
ECG show
- regular
- No P wave
- narrow QRS
This is SVT
I did modified valsalva manoeuvre and the rhythm regain but unfortunately I didn’t take Video.
Modified valsalva manoeuvre done by
- keep patient in sitting position with extended legs
- ask patient to take deep breaths and then breathe out though closed mouth and nouse or against syringe or bottle and number 15 second
- after that lye the patient and elevate his legs about 90 degrees
Do this manoeuvre with cardiac monitor.
60 years old male with history of IHD presented with chest pain?.
ECG show
- ST elevation lead I, avL and V2
- reciprocal ST depression in inferior leads mainly lead III.
This called high lateral MI due to occlusion in the first diagonal branch D1 of left anterior descending coronary artery.
Criteria
- ST elevation in lead I, avL and V2
- reciprocal ST depression in inferior lead mainly III.
This called South Africa 🇿🇦 flag sign.
Beta blocker in heart failure
Only
- bisoprolol
- metoprolol *succinate*
- carvidilol
Should be started at very low dose and titrated up with 1–2 weeks and target of heart rate about 55-60 bpm.
@ Avoid starting in acute pulmonary oedema
@ after starting the feature of heart failure increase don’t stop the treatment with the time the symptoms improve.
46 years old female presented with SOB , sweating and paler. During examination there was dyspnea , tachycardia, good air entry bilateral and huger for breath.
Vital show low SPO2, hypotension and tachycardia.
She did liposuction operation before 2 days.
ECG show
- sinus tachycardia
- S1Q3T3
- poor progression of R wave in pericardial leads
- persistent deep S in V6.
D dimer elevated
Echo study show right side over load with pulmonary pressure 65 mmHG.
Patient unfortunately passed.
This is pulmonary embolism.

54 years old male with DM, smoking and positive family history of IHD. Presented with sever chest pain and positive S troponine.
ECG show
- irregular, narrow QRS and no P wave >>> atrial fibrillation
- widespread ST depression and ST elevation in avR
- there is three differential diagnosis ( triple vessel disease, proximal LAD and left a main stem occlusion). His brother had CABG , make triple vessel disease at the top of differential diagnosis
Echo study show mild LV dysfunction
Treatment
- aspirin 300
- plavix 300
- heparin 5,000 IU IV
- atrovastatin 80 mg
- ACE inhibitors or ARBS
- GTN
- beta blocker like bisoprolol
- small dose of diuretic
- heparin infusion (25,000 IU )
Then the patient need angiography and the other related to cardiologist.
Sinus rhythm with supranational ( atrial ectopic beat bigmeni)
Criteria of supranational ectopic beats
- come early
- preceded by abnormal P wave morphology or absent P wave
- same shape of sinus beats as the ectopic beat above the AV node and pass through the AV node and take the same shape of sinus beat
- post ectopic wide distance

Moderate mitral stenosis due to rheumatic fever.
Echo finding
- fusion of mitral valve cumissure
- domino g of anterior mitral valve leaflet which take shape of hockey 🏑 stick appearance
- mild dilation of left atrial
ECG : normal
Treatment
- beta block
- diuretic ( as the left atrial pressure increases >> increase in the pulmonary vessels pressure >> pulmonary congestion >> pulmonary odema
- aspirin to decrease the thrombus formation due to stasis of blood
Serial follow up.

Sometimes when you receive like this ECG
You will shocked and don’t know the head from the toes by as simple
- is it regular ? , No it is irregular but P wave present so this is not AF
- is the ECG narrow QRS or wide ? It is wide QRS and had different morphology
Those with P wave take shape of LBBB ( deep S in V 1 and rS in V6 or M shape with T wave inversion in lead Iand avL) , while those that not preceded by P wave was also wide , different morphology from the preceding beat with wide distance after these beats so this is ventricular ectopic beats). Not the supranodal ectopic beats pass from the AV not and take the shape of preceding beats so if the normal beats has bundle block the ectopic beats will take the same block.
-read the ST and T wave changes in normal beats not in ectopic beats ( which occur unfortunately by resident doctor and manage the case as ischemia and so on
- try to search for the causes of ectopic beats like Ischmic, electrolytes, myopathy, drug like digoxin toxicity and so on
45 years old female presented with sudden onset of SOB. He had negative history of IHD,no structural heart disease, no history of fever, no history of pregnancy and so on. He just had tenderness in the right legs
Spo2 :92%
HR:140 bpm
BP:100:65 mmHg
ECG show
- sinus tachycardia
- slightly right axis deviation ( negative R in avL and positive in lead II)
- slightly S1Q3 and flat T wave in lead III
- partial RBBB
- persistent deep S in V6
All of these are strains pattern over the right side
Echo study show
- dilation Right side
- slightly fluttering in the intraventricular septa
- D shape in the left ventricular in the short axis
- tricuspid regurgitation with pulmonary pressure about 49mmHg.
Pressure overload.
D dimer elevated
CT angiography show pulmonary embolism
Patient take actilyase (200 mg over 2 hour) there is improvement
- decreased the dyspnea
- decreased the heart rate to 105 bpm
- improved BP
- also echo study show decrease the pressure overload over the right side ونسالكم الدعاء

As simple as that there is
- widespread ST depression
- fattening of T wave
- prolongation of QT interval
- u wave appear in some lead but not clearly
Clinically weakness in the upper and lower limbs
Lab study sever hypokalemia
